常用名 敌敌畏 英文名 Dichlorvos
CAS号 62-73-7 分子量 220.976
密度 1.4±0.1 g/cm3 沸点 176.8±40.0 °C at 760 mmHg
分子式 C4H7Cl2O4P 熔点 -60°C
MSDS 中文版 美版 闪点 14.7±35.0 °C
符号 GHS06 GHS09
GHS06, GHS09
信号词 Danger
